Check-in time for retreats is 2-4 p.m. Central Time. Vespers in the Archabbey Church is at 5 p.m., followed by supper. The opening conference typically begins at 7:30 p.m. The retreat concludes with lunch on the last day of the program. A complete schedule will be provided at check-in.

A Step 11 Retreat for Recovering Alcoholics and Alanons

Friday, July 12, 2019 - Sunday, July 14, 2019
Location: Archabbey Guest House and Retreat Center
Session Faculty: Dave Maloney

(AA Retreat) – This retreat is for those seeking, through heartfelt prayer and meditation, to improve their conscious contract with God, as they understand Him, praying only for knowledge of His will for them and the power to carry it out with guided meditation, lectio divina, praying with the monks and group sharing. This retreat is designed for those who wish to abandon themselves to God. ($255 single, $425 double)
